Hungary To Expand Gas Transmission System For TurkStream By End Of 2019 - Russia's Novak

ST. PETERSBURG (UrduPoint News / Sputnik - 06th June, 2019) Hungary has confirmed that it will by the end of the year expand its gas transportation system for gas that will be delivered via the TurkStream pipeline, Russian Energy Minister Alexander Novak said on Thursday on the sidelines of the St. Petersburg International Economic Forum (SPIEF).
"By the end of the year," Novak said, asked what the time frame for expanding Hungary's gas transmission system was.
The energy minister also added that new gas transportation facilities in Hungary would be transporting 6-10 billion cubic meters (212-353 billion cubic feet) of gas.
The TurkStream twin-pipeline will have a maximum capacity of 31.5 billion cubic meters a year. The first leg will deliver Russian gas under the Black Sea to Turkey for local consumption and is expected to become operational by January 1, 2020. The second leg is to carry gas to Southern and Central Europe, but its route has not been determined yet.
SPIEF began earlier on Thursday and will last through Saturday. Rossiya Segodnya International Information Agency is an official media partner of the forum.
